It was on no account going to happen in a single day, nevertheless one issue is for sure—ray tracing is the place graphics are headed. The issue, actually, is the large strain that ray-traced rendering has on {{hardware}}. Nonetheless, Microsoft has made a concerted effort to type of facet step the problem with its DirectX Raytracing (DXR) API, and now the company is offering builders a preview of what new suggestions and capabilities are to come back again.

Microsoft’s preview is unquestionably a broader overview of a group of choices headed to DirectX 12 (DX12). The one we’re most centered on, nonetheless, is a model new tier of ray tracing help (tier 1.1).  They embody the subsequent:

  • Assist for together with additional shaders to an current Raytracing PSO, which drastically will improve effectivity of dynamic PSO additions.
  • Assist ExecuteIndirect for Raytracing, which permits adaptive algorithms the place the number of rays is ready on the GPU execution timeline.
  • Introduce Inline Raytracing, which gives further direct administration of the ray traversal algorithm and shader scheduling, a a lot much less superior numerous when the whole shader-based raytracing system is overkill, and further flexibility since RayQuery could also be often known as from every shader stage. It moreover opens new DXR use circumstances, significantly in compute: culling, physics, occlusion queries, and so forth.

Beneath all that technobabble is a set of devices and choices supposed to help builders greater expose the capabilities of graphics {{hardware}}, and as well as “deal with adoption ache elements.” In several phrases, this may help facilitate a sooner movement into ray-traced territory.

This will likely very effectively be significantly needed as AMD jumps on the bandwagon with a future mannequin of Navi. At present, solely Nvidia’s GeForce RTX assortment of graphics enjoying playing cards present devoted ray tracing {{hardware}} to consumers, nevertheless that is anticipated to range subsequent yr. Everyone knows for sure a mannequin of Navi with hardware-based ray tracing help is headed to the PlayStation 5 on the finish of 2020, and we’re extra more likely to see the similar issue on PC spherical that time as successfully.

Microsoft moreover highlighted one other points headed to DirectX 12, along with mesh shaders and amplification shaders. These characterize the “subsequent know-how of GPU geometry processing performance,” technical particulars of which can be specified by a blog post. Summed up, these may lead to sooner load events, notably at elevated resolutions, resembling 4K.

LEAVE A REPLY

Please enter your comment!
Please enter your name here